What Happened

In March 2024, Duolingo unveiled a conversational feature powered by a large language model that can simulate real‑time dialogues in over 30 languages. The rollout follows a year‑long partnership with leading research labs that refined the model’s ability to follow user instructions and stay on‑topic.

Concurrently, a coalition of researchers from OpenAI, Georgetown University’s Center for Security and Emerging Technology, and the Stanford Internet Observatory released a joint report warning that the same technology could be weaponized for disinformation campaigns if left unchecked.

To pre‑empt misuse, the developers introduced a curated fine‑tuning dataset that aligns model behavior with safety and truthfulness standards, making the system less prone to generate toxic or deceptive content.

Key Details

The new Duolingo bot can handle up to five turns of conversation without repeating prompts, a 40 % improvement over its 2023 predecessor. Internal testing showed learners’ quiz scores rose an average of 12 % after just two weeks of regular use.

The disinformation workshop held in October 2021 gathered 30 experts—spanning machine‑learning engineers, policy analysts, and former intelligence officers—to map out plausible attack vectors. Their findings highlighted three primary risks: automated rumor generation, targeted political persuasion, and large‑scale phishing scripts.

Fine‑tuning on a 5,000‑example curated dataset reduced the model’s toxic output by 78 % and increased factual accuracy on benchmark tests from 71 % to 89 %. These gains stem from the “Instruct” training paradigm, which emphasizes human feedback loops.

Background

Large language models have evolved from few‑shot learners—capable of performing tasks after seeing only a handful of examples—to robust instruction‑following systems. Early iterations, released in 2020, struggled with consistency, prompting a research shift toward “human‑in‑the‑loop” alignment techniques.

Education technology firms quickly recognized the potential: by embedding conversational agents, they could offer immersive practice that mimics native speakers. Yet the same flexibility raised alarms among security scholars, who warned that the same models could synthesize persuasive narratives at scale.

Why It Matters

For language learners, the impact is immediate. “I felt more confident speaking Spanish after just a week of using the new bot,” said Maria Torres, a college sophomore in Boston. “The system corrected my mistakes gently and kept the conversation flowing.” Such anecdotal evidence aligns with the 12 % score lift reported by Duolingo’s analytics team.

From a societal standpoint, the dual‑use nature of these models underscores a pressing policy dilemma. The joint research report cautioned that without proactive safeguards, malicious actors could exploit the technology to flood social media with tailored falsehoods, potentially swaying public opinion during elections.

What Happens Next

Duolingo plans to roll out the conversational feature to its premium subscribers worldwide by July 2024, while continuing to monitor user feedback for bias and safety issues. The company also pledged to share anonymized interaction data with academic partners to further refine alignment methods.

On the regulatory front, lawmakers in the European Union are drafting a “Digital Disinformation Act” that would require developers of large language models to undergo third‑party safety audits before public release. If enacted, the legislation could set a global benchmark for responsible deployment.
